What they do

An Entertainment or Recreation Attendant works at an entertainment or recreation facility such as a golf course, tennis court, ballpark or amusement park. May staff a concession stand, rent or sell equipment, collect fees from members, or manage reservations for use of facilities. May run amusement park rides, sell or collect tickets, or fasten restraints for people on rides.

JOB DUTIES
1. Assist OHV personnel relating to Off-Highway Vehicle recreation programs, events, and daily park operations. 2. Collect and account for money received. 3. Collect OHV related fees. 4. Issue OHV related permits and prepare written receipts. 5. Provide information hand-outs to visitors. 6. Answer OHV recreation related questions. 7. Perform light maintenance and cleaning of workstation and facilities. 8. Perform data entry. 9. Perform duties as deemed necessary and essential to facilitate a temporary "Permit" sale workstation. 10. Assist in First Aid Station.
MINIMUM REQUIREMENTS
1. Ability to follow oral and written instructions. 2. Ability to work harmoniously with fellow employees and the public. 3. Ability to prepare clear and concise record sheets. 4. Ability to collect and account for all money received. Must have the ability to write clearly and concisely and keep a clean work area. 5.
Have knowledge of:
laws, safe practices, and regulations relating to OHV recreation; not required but preferred. 6. Possess valid California Driver's License and good driving record. 7. Possess High School Diploma or GED Certificate. 8. Possess current First Aide/CPR certificate. 9. First Response experienced preferred
